Engineered Polymer Systems (EPS) Division designs and manufactures engineered elastomeric, polymeric and plastic seals and sealing systems for dynamic applications. Our commitment to developing world-class materials that meet or exceed industry specifications allows our customers to focus on equipment design.

Engineering Expertise

We utilize our engineering expertise along with state of the art R&D test facilities and Parker developed finite element analysis (FEA) techniques to quickly develop sealing system solutions. Our material scientists are experts in polymer development. Our product and application engineering teams understand the real world problems facing design engineers. Together, our teams collaborate to create and innovate – and solve difficult sealing challenges.

Responsible for meeting customer performance expectations through document control. Reviews customer specifications and compiles certification packages to achieve business objectives of assigned customer accounts.

• Compiles and maintains control records and related files to release blueprints, drawings, and engineering documents to manufacturing and other operating departments.

• Inspection of parts and completion of inspection reports.

• Examines documents, such as blueprints, drawings, change orders, and specifications to verify completeness and accuracy of data.

• Confers with document originators or engineering liaison personnel to resolve discrepancies and compiles required changes to documents.

• Posts changes to computerized or manual control records, releases documents, and notifies affected department.

• Other duties as assigned.

• U.S. Citizenship or have U.S. Permanent Resident Status required. Education : High School Graduate or General Education Degree (GED)

• Experience : 5+ years’ experience in a quality or manufacturing related background a plus

• Excellent clerical and organizational skills; interpersonal, communication, and writing skills a must. ISO experience is a plus. Knowledge of GD&T is a plus.

• Computer Skills : Microsoft Office applications (Word, Excel, and Power Point) Outlook, Power BI, SharePoint, and Teams.
